The presets you are calling “radio buttons” are more like Windows shortcuts than presets. You can use them to access various functions without going through all the menus.
For example, I have the first button set to recall the list of station favorites I have saved for Sirius XM. I press the button once and it switches to Sirius and I get a list of radio stations. I have another button set up to switch to navigation, with a default destination of home. |

I first use a “radio button” to switch to my short list of favorite stations, and that list is what is displayed on the iDrive screen (I only set up 5 or 6, but maybe the list can be longer).
Then I can turn the thumb wheel on the steering wheel controls and it just cycles through the short list of presets. Press down on the thumb wheel to pick a station. |
